Hotel Manalba is an exceptional stay in Mexico City—truly a gem for travelers exploring the region. What stands out most is their generous luggage storage policy: they’ll hold your bags for up to eight days, which is incredibly convenient if you're using the city as a base for short trips across Mexico. It lets you travel light and explore nearby destinations without the hassle of carrying heavy suitcases back and forth. The staff are warm, welcoming, and genuinely attentive—especially David, the bellboy, who went above and beyond with his kindness and helpfulness. Their hospitality truly makes a lasting impression. That said, there are a few areas for improvement. Noise from hallways and neighboring rooms can be distracting, especially late at night when loud voices or drunken laughter disrupt sleep. A reminder about respectful behavior would go a long way. For better guest comfort, I’d suggest adding a 'Do Not Disturb' sign that guests can hang on the door—no one wants to be woken up by cleaning staff around 8 a.m. Also, during cooler months, the lack of heating makes the room feel chilly; having a functioning air conditioning system (with heat mode) would make a big difference. Lastly, while the room is already spotless and well-maintained, a mini-fridge would be a welcome addition—perfect for storing drinks, snacks, or medication. One more highlight: the Maya deity statue placed right outside the elevator is stunning and adds such a unique cultural touch. It’s clear this hotel celebrates Mexican heritage in thoughtful ways. I’d definitely return here on my next trip to Mexico City.

Staying at Suites Contempo was an absolute delight. The hotel is spotless and incredibly well-equipped—my room even came with a full kitchen, complete with utensils, and a washer-dryer combo, making it perfect for extended stays. The location is unbeatable: just steps away from Reforma Avenue and Chapultepec Park, ideal for morning runs or dining out. Right outside the door, there’s an OXXO and a 7-Eleven, so grabbing snacks or essentials is super convenient. Clean, comfortable, and thoughtfully designed—this place feels like home while still offering all the perks of a premium stay. I’d highly recommend it to anyone looking for a relaxed yet central base in Mexico City.
